The Inevitable


 

As much as we loved each other
deep within our hearts we knew
it wouldn't last forever
we held on as long as we could
hoping and wishing that maybe someday
things would work out in our favor
but our someday never came
and we both knew we were
prolonging the inevitable

 

Yet, neither one of us wanted
to be the first to sever the tie
that bridged the distance
between your heart and mine
despite all the tears we've shed
and all those lonely nights
we lay awake in our beds
so torn apart inside
prolonging the inevitable

 

We've used up all our chances
running around in circles
trying to mend broken fences
while praying for a miracle
 and realized that it's over
as we severed the tie
that bound us together
with pain and sadness 
we accepted the inevitable
